Output 6373e820f756a2286d0b9cd2110353f4308df95586bba6709b10b7018d7c2efd:22

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c32ed80c7b1c8529ae902e04f1657830c524ac053d3b26e3848722e36b15facd
address
bc1pcvhdsrrmrjzjnt5s9cz0zetcxrzjftq985ajdcuysu3wx6c4ltxsmymr92
transaction
6373e820f756a2286d0b9cd2110353f4308df95586bba6709b10b7018d7c2efd
confirmations
22184
spent
true